Drug-likeness

Descriptor-based ADME screening flags from SMILES. These are not experimental toxicity results.

Permeability proxy Check

Estimated from TPSA and LogP only: TPSA ≤ 90 Ų and −1 ≤ LogP ≤ 5 are treated as a favorable small-molecule permeability screen.

  • TPSA ≤ 90 Ų 232.6
  • −1 ≤ LogP ≤ 5 -1.11
Lipinski's Rule of Five Fail 2 violations
  • MW ≤ 500 Da 455.3
  • LogP ≤ 5 -1.11
  • H-bond donors ≤ 5 6
  • H-bond acceptors ≤ 10 12
Veber's rules Fail
  • Rotatable bonds ≤ 10 8
  • TPSA ≤ 140 Ų 232.6
PAINS Clean

No PAINS structural alerts detected.
